Soviet Policy Toward The Baltic States, 1918-1940 is a comprehensive historical account of the Soviet Union's policies towards Estonia, Latvia, and Lithuania during the interwar period. The author, Albert N. Tarulis, examines the political, economic, and social factors that influenced Soviet policies towards the Baltic States, including the Soviet Union's desire for strategic access to the Baltic Sea, its ideological commitment to communism, and its efforts to suppress nationalist movements in the region. Tarulis analyzes the impact of Soviet policies on the Baltic States, including the forced collectivization of agriculture, the suppression of political dissent, and the annexation of the Baltic States into the Soviet Union in 1940. The book provides a nuanced understanding of the complex relationship between the Soviet Union and the Baltic States during a critical period in European history.This scarce antiquarian book is a facsimile reprint of the old original and may contain some imperfections such as library marks and notations.
